What Makes a Comeback Season?
Before we dive into the artists and their new tracks, let's understand what makes a comeback season. It's not just about an artist releasing new music; it's about their return to the limelight after a significant break. This could be due to various reasons - a hiatus to focus on personal growth, a break to start a family, or even a much-needed rest after a grueling tour schedule. Whatever the reason, the comeback season is all about new beginnings and fresh perspectives.

The Future of Comeback Seasons
As the music industry continues to evolve, so too will the comeback season. With the rise of streaming platforms and social media, artists have more control than ever over their careers, and this is reflected in their comebacks. We're seeing more surprise releases, more experimental sounds, and more artists taking their time to create music that truly resonates with them.
